  5. Connie Francis was - without a doubt - the best-selling female vocalist of the R&R era. She set the pace, and was untoppable and unstoppable well into the '60s Here we bring together all of her 1950s recordings with hits like Who's Sorry Now, Stupid Cupid, My Happiness and Among My Souvenirs. There are many unissued recordings, the duets with Marvin Rainwater, and all those ultra-rare early LPs.

  7. Connie Francis (born Concetta Rosa Maria Franconero, December 12, 1938) is an American pop singer of Italian heritage and the top-charting female vocalist of the 1950s and 1960s. Although her chart success waned in the second half of the 1960s, Francis remained a top concert draw.
